▏A Sequence of Experiences
Located in the coastal city of Al Khiran in the southern part of Kuwait, an otherworldly setting where the Kuwaiti desert meets the expanse of Arabian Gulf, White Fortress is a private residence designed by TAEP/AAP, an architecture and engineering practice with offices in Kuwait, Portugal, and France. Situated on a man-made peninsula, part of an ambitious coastal development, its contemporary form embraces privacy, discretion, and sustainable living in the spirit of the region’s architectural heritage. Unfolding as a sequence of experiences, choreographed through patios, gardens, and shifting pathways, this is a place of quiet grandeur—its ascetic, minimalist aesthetic further enhancing its contemplative dialogue with its environment.
▏Nature and Architecture Coalesce in Poetic Harmony
The project’s defining gesture, and the inspiration for its name, is its towering perimeter walls—stoic, monumental, and deeply rooted in Northern Gulf traditions of enclosure and protection. These walls shield the home from the relentless Kuwaiti sun and the arid winds, creating a realm within, where nature and architecture coalesce in poetic harmony. Within this walled enclave, the residence unfolds through a succession of courtyards and gardens. Confronting the constraints of a long and narrow plot, the introduction of these elements, along with meandering paths that interlace them, imbues the project with a sense of wonder.
▏Embracing its Coastal Position
Embracing its coastal position, the plot terminates in an open, semi-covered terrace overlooking the sea. This space is the home’s ultimate threshold, a liminal zone between the building and the private beach that encapsulates the intimate relationship between the architecture and its natural setting. Landscaping also plays a crucial role in this dialogue, with native vegetation interwoven into the building volumes. These natural elements temper the built environment, reinforcing the home’s commitment to a sensorial connection with its surroundings.
In its current context, White Fortress is a paradox—a secluded stronghold within Sabah Al Ahmad Sea City, a master-planned city set to accommodate 250,000 residents over the coming decades spread over 200 kilometres of waterfront unfolding across an intricate web of artificial canals. As this new coastal world takes shape, the residence stands as an early marker, a home that looks both at the present and the future, where traditional sensibilities and modern aspirations find common ground.
